Effect of substructure and mating system on low temperature resistance of EPDM
The conventional and low-temperature retraction properties of several different grades of EPDM were explored,and the effects of different ethylene and tertiary monomer contents on the comprehensive properties of EPDM were investigated.The effects of different plasticizers and vulcanization systems on the performance of EPDM were compared.The experimental results show that,under the peroxide vulcanization system,with the higher ENB content in the molecular structure of EPDM,the degree of vulcanization of rubber and the tensile strength increases gradually;the higher the ethylene content,the tensile elongation of the rubber increases.Under the experimental setting conditions,EPDM vulcanized by peroxide has better mechanical properties,and the sulfur vulcanization system can reduce the TR 10 of EPDM.Compared with paraffine 2280,TR10 of EPDM of paraffine 6010 is significantly reduced.
